Kitchen Remodel

This suburban home was first built in the 60’s by the original owner who was an architect. As a result, the interior features a very unique style that features an open floor plan and exposed heavy timber beams. The original kitchen, however, was rather small and enclosed by two walls.

We opened up the kitchen by integrating it into the rest of the open floor plan home. The extension of the kitchen allowed for us to install a large island with storage on both sides as well as another section of pull-out cabinets along the stairwell. Finally, with the new layout, we decided to go with a modern approach which complements and accentuates the style of the original architecture.
